Estate properties are grand
in scale and atmosphere, consisting
of appropriately proportioned
design elements drawn with broad
'strokes' and a certain
sophisticated simplicity.
The estate property is often filled
with ‘garden’ rooms
of differing character, co-ordinated
with axial vantages and distinct
sculptural elements. Clipped boxwood
hedges may braid together in a
formal knot garden or hybrid rose
gardens form a scented oasis and
cutting garden. Whether formal
or grand, an estate garden will
give the finishing touches to
your property, bringing together
Architecture and Landscape.
